Key Elements of Modern Design
One of the hallmarks of modern architecture is its focus on simplicity. No longer are the times of elaborate decor; modern styles embrace sleek, uncomplicated lines. Another fundamental idea is the fusion with technology and sustainability, where buildings are designed to be energy-efficient and minimize the ecological footprint.
The Role of Innovation in Modern Design
Incorporating technology into design processes is crucial for realizing contemporary design goals. From smart home systems to cutting-edge construction resources, innovators are investigating ways to improve performance and operability. 3D printing and virtual reality are transforming the design landscape by allowing for quick prototyping and immersive design journeys.
